What are the 4 types of cloud computing?
There are four main types : private clouds, public clouds, hybrid clouds, and multiclouds. There are also three main types of cloud computing services: Infrastructure-as-a-Service (IaaS), Platforms-as-a-Service (PaaS), and Software-as-a-Service (SaaS)

Which software is used for it?
PaaS (Platform as a Service) solution uses third-party service providers to deliver hardware and software tools to enterprises over the internet. Examples of PaaS services in it computing are IBM Cloud, AWS, Red Hat OpenShift, and Oracle Cloud Platform (OCP).

Conclusion
One advantage of cloud computing is that it’s more cheap. To reap the greatest rewards from it, a startup or greenfield project might be constructed with loose coupling. But, it’s crucial to carefully consider whether an application is designed in a way that allows it to get the full benefits of cloud before migrating it to the cloud. If not, moving to the cloud could result in higher operational expenses. In order to achieve the best potential cost efficiency after adopting the cloud, we must regularly monitor how we use our resources and expand our deployment to match the need for computing power.
